How It Works
So, how do public defenders like those at the Pasco County Public Defender Office work? In short, they represent individuals who cannot afford to hire a private attorney. This includes defendants in felony and misdemeanor cases, as well as those facing juvenile court proceedings. Public defenders work tirelessly to gather evidence, interview witnesses, and develop a strong defense strategy to ensure their clients receive a fair trial.
Common Questions
- What is the role of a public defender?
A public defender's role is to provide legal representation to individuals who cannot afford to hire a private attorney. This includes defending their clients in court, investigating the facts of the case, and working to negotiate a favorable plea agreement or verdict.
- How are public defenders different from private attorneys?
Public defenders are government-funded lawyers who work solely on behalf of their clients, whereas private attorneys may have multiple clients and priorities. Public defenders also often work with limited resources, making their job even more challenging.
- What are some of the challenges facing public defenders?
Public defenders often face heavy caseloads, limited resources, and bureaucratic hurdles. They may also face pressure to prioritize cases and focus on getting plea agreements, rather than pushing for trials.
Opportunities and Realistic Risks
While advocating for the innocent is a crucial aspect of the public defender's role, there are also realistic risks involved. Public defenders may face pressure from judges, prosecutors, and even their own clients to plea bargain, even if they believe their client is innocent. They may also face challenges in gathering evidence and developing a strong defense strategy, particularly in cases with complex facts or scientific evidence.
